What is Nanogel?
Nanogel is a groundbreaking material used in various industries due to its unique properties.
It is a type of aerogel composed of a nanoporous structure that is incredibly lightweight and effective at dissipating energy.
These properties make nanogel an ideal candidate for improving the shock absorption capabilities of children’s furniture, including pine chairs.
Key Properties of Nanogel
1. **Lightweight**: Nanogel is incredibly light, adding minimal weight when incorporated into furniture design.
2. **Energy Dissipation**: It can absorb and dissipate energy effectively, making it a great shock absorber.
3. **Thermal Insulation**: While primarily known for its energy-absorbing properties, nanogel also provides excellent thermal insulation.
4. **Durability**: Despite its delicate appearance, nanogel is remarkably durable, maintaining its structure over time.
Integrating Nanogel into Pine Children’s Chairs
Incorporating nanogel into the design of pine children’s chairs offers enhanced safety through improved shock absorption.
Here’s how this integration is achieved:
Design Process
Designers begin by identifying areas of the chair most susceptible to impact, such as the seat and backrest.
These sections are then fitted with nanogel-infused padding, strategically placed to maximize energy absorption without compromising the chair’s original design.
The nanogel can also be layered under the chair’s finish, thereby maintaining the chair’s aesthetic appeal.
Manufacturing Concerns
While nanogel offers numerous benefits, its inclusion in furniture requires a specific manufacturing approach.
Manufacturers must ensure that the nanogel is evenly distributed to guarantee consistent performance.
Additionally, securing the nanogel in place during the assembly process is crucial to maintaining durability over time.
